How Do I Determine the Best Battery for My BMW 325i 2006?

To determine the best battery for your 2006 BMW 325i, consider the following key factors: battery size, cold cranking amps (CCA), reserve capacity (RC), and the type of battery.

Battery size: For the 2006 BMW 325i, the recommended group size is typically 94R. This size ensures that the battery fits properly in the vehicle’s battery tray and connects correctly with the terminals.

Cold cranking amps (CCA): CCA measures a battery’s ability to start your engine in cold temperatures. For the 2006 BMW 325i, you should look for a battery with a CCA rating of at least 600 amps. This rating ensures reliable starting power, especially in colder climates.

Reserve capacity (RC): RC indicates how long the battery can power the vehicle’s electrical system if the alternator fails. A battery with at least 100 minutes of RC is advisable for the 2006 BMW 325i. This rating provides enough time for you to reach assistance if needed.

Type of battery: The 2006 BMW 325i typically uses a lead-acid battery, but you can also consider an absorbed glass mat (AGM) battery. AGM batteries offer better performance, longer life, and superior resistance to vibration. They are also maintenance-free, making them a convenient option.

Manufacturer recommendations: Always check the owner’s manual for any manufacturer-specific recommendations regarding the battery. This document provides vital information on compatibility and performance standards expected for the vehicle.

By analyzing these factors, you can select a battery that matches your BMW 325i’s requirements for performance and reliability.

What Are the Warning Signs That My 2006 BMW 325i Needs a New Battery?

The warning signs that your 2006 BMW 325i needs a new battery include dim headlights, slow engine cranking, electronic issues, and a warning light on the dashboard.

  1. Dim headlights
  2. Slow engine cranking
  3. Electronic issues
  4. Warning light

These signs indicate potential battery failure. The following are detailed explanations of each warning sign.

  1. Dim Headlights:
    Dim headlights indicate low battery voltage. When the battery cannot provide adequate power, the brightness of the headlights diminishes. This can worsen when accessories like the air conditioning or radio are in use. How Do I Properly Install a New Battery in My BMW 325i 2006?

To properly install a new battery in your 2006 BMW 325i, you need to gather the necessary tools, safely remove the old battery, and correctly position the new one.

  1. Gather necessary tools:
    – You will need a socket wrench, typically a 10mm size for the battery terminals.
    – Safety gloves and goggles are recommended to protect yourself from battery acid and debris.

  2. Turn off the vehicle:
    – Ensure the car is completely powered off. Remove the key from the ignition and close all doors to avoid any accidental electrical shorts during the installation.

  3. Locate the battery:
    – The battery in the 2006 BMW 325i is located in the trunk. Open the trunk and lift the floor mat or cover to access the battery compartment.

  4. Remove the old battery:
    – Disconnect the negative terminal first (usually black). Loosen the bolt with the socket wrench and remove the cable from the terminal.
    – Next, disconnect the positive terminal (usually red) following the same process.
    – Securely lift the old battery out of the compartment, taking care as it can be heavy.

  5. Clean the terminal posts:
    – Use a wire brush and baking soda solution to clean the terminals. This will remove corrosion and ensure a good connection for the new battery.

  6. Place the new battery:
    – Position the new battery in the compartment, ensuring the positive terminal aligns with the positive cable and the negative terminal with the negative cable.

  7. Connect the new battery:
    – Start with the positive terminal. Slide the cable onto the terminal and tighten the bolt securely with the socket wrench.
    – Next, connect the negative terminal in the same manner. Ensure both connections are secure to avoid any electrical issues.

  8. Close everything up:
    – Replace the battery cover if applicable and ensure the floor mat is secured back in place.

  9. Test the installation:
    – Start the vehicle to make sure the new battery is functioning correctly. Check that all electrical components are operational.

Following these steps will ensure a successful installation of your new battery, maintaining your BMW 325i in proper working order.

How Can I Maximize the Lifespan of My BMW 325i’s Battery?

To maximize the lifespan of your BMW 325i’s battery, maintain regular checks, ensure proper charging, keep the battery clean, control the temperature, and minimize electrical drain.

Regular checks: Frequently inspect the battery for any signs of corrosion or damage. Corrosion can lead to poor connections. A study by AAA (2021) shows that regular maintenance can increase battery life by up to 50%.

Proper charging: Ensure that your car battery is charged appropriately. Undercharging or overcharging may damage the battery. It is best to keep the battery charge between 12.4 and 12.7 volts when not in use.

Keep the battery clean: Clean the battery terminals and connections to prevent power loss. Dirt and grime can create resistance. Use a mixture of baking soda and water to clean corroded terminals, followed by a thorough drying.

Control the temperature: Keeping the battery at an optimal temperature can extend its life. Extreme heat can evaporate the battery’s fluids. Conversely, extreme cold can reduce the battery’s capacity. Park your vehicle in a garage during extreme weather to mitigate these effects.

Minimize electrical drain: Avoid leaving lights and electronics on when the engine is off. Using electrical features without the engine running drains the battery. According to the Department of Energy (2022), excessive electrical load can significantly shorten battery life.

By following these guidelines, you can enhance the longevity and performance of your BMW 325i’s battery.
